About Magtens Korridorer
Magtens Korridorer have existed in the danish underground for many years, but with their album "Friværdi" They have finally made it into the mainstream. They did, though, have a big cult hit "Hestevise" in the radioshow "Tæskeholdet" in the late nineties. They play old-school rock'n'roll, inspired by bands like Gasolin', but clearly with punk roots as well. This they combine with refreshing unpretentious and satirical lyrics about everyday life.
Frontman Johan G. Olsen is also a professor in biology at Københavns Universitet.
The band opened the Roskilde Festival at the orange scene in 2006.
The bands central members since the start are
Johan G. Olsen (vocal) and Rasmus Kern (guitar).
